Yeah, I love this Mysterio figure as well...have a major soft spot for some of Spidey's goofy rogues' gallery, and Mysterio is among the upper echelon of them. It's really just a fantastically well-done figure with a perfect color scheme and sculpt, which I'm surprised that Hasbro put so much effort/tooling/money into. I mean, who else could they use that body for?
And that head sculpt...brilliant. I know some people are weirded out by it, but I think that Lovecraftian nightmare under Mysterio's globe is just amazing. After all, he's a special effects guy and a master of illusion, so why wouldn't he use smoke and mirrors to make it look like something truly horrifying was under there instead of just his regular, everyday mug?
Also, I've seen variants where his head sculpt is green instead of white, and I honestly prefer the white head. With the green one it's just too much green on the figure overall, and under the globe the white head gives the appearance of the globe being filled with mist, with something weird/unsettling inside that's just BARELY visible...so creepy.
Bonus points for the green smoke attachments that clip onto Mysterio's legs (that, like the head, have tentacles growing out of them). Mysterio and Gwenpool are the best figures in this wave, IMO.
